This resort is gorgeous and they have really thought of everything to make your stay comfortable. The staff are friendly and very polite. This resort caters to families with children so if you are looking for a romantic getaway for two this is not your choice, although they do have plenty of activities for adults. The Cove seemed to be more adult oriented but is also the most expensive. The resort is huge and very busy. Be prepared for long food lines, long water ride lines, etc. The pool chairs are hard to come by and for a decent spot you have to be up at 7 AM. Restaurant reservations book fast and you might not be able to get your choices. They charge 15% gratuity on everything you buy, even a bottle of water. Be ready to spend some serious cash as the prices are pretty high.

Our original honeymoon was to the Bahamas, before Atlantis was 'born' so we decided to go back to the islands for our 20-year anniversary. Having the combination of the beach, fabulous pools and the Casino so close was perfect! We stayed in the Coral Towers, an older facility but offering a very centralized location to everything. The rooms were clean and we had a first floor terrace view giving us a patio with chairs/table to sit at and admire beautiful tropical foliage with a small lagoon of sharks a few feet away - very cool. It rained several times while we were there so we used this time to take in the fantastic indoor fish tanks, listen to the local musicians in each gathering area and then sit out on the covered patio with some wine and think back over the last 20 years. While Coral Towers isn't the newest or fanciest, it offered clean rooms, albeit ours was a bit smoky smelling, a friendly staff everywhere we went, a library with free daily internet and a centralized location just 2 or 3 minutes of indoor walking from the marina, the pools, shopping, the Casino and multiple restaurants. Yes, the food is expensive and a 15% gratuity is added to everything but it's a resort and something we just planned for and have seen at other resorts as well. The Breakfast Buffet ($28) was limited in comparison to those we enjoy in Las Vegas so unless you need a lot of food, explore your options. We did make a quick 5-minute walk to the Marina/Harbor Village to pick up some cheaper sodas, wine, snacks and Dunkin Donuts at the little grocery store but bring your own wine bottle opener unless you want to spend $6 on one there. Overall a great experience and would definitely go back with the kids, plus the lines for the water rides were non-existent in the light rain - a plus for us over 40-somethings!

Once a private estate, One&Only Ocean Club rests between miles of pristine beach and exquisite gardens inspired by the romantic grandeur of Versailles. Fragrant blossoms of hibiscus and bougainvillea, along with hand-laid rock ridges and stone steps, ascend the terraced garden decorated with bronze and marble statues from Europe. At its apex stand the dramatic arches of a 12th- century Augustinian cloister boasting spectacular sunset views over Nassau Harbour.
